## Release 2.9.0 — Changed defaults

The Bucketeer assignment service changed several defaults in this release, and as a new contractor you should read these carefully before touching any experiment definitions. Sticky assignment is now on by default, the hash salt rotates per experiment rather than globally, and stale-variant eviction dropped from 30 days to 14. Existing experiments keep their recorded settings; only newly created ones pick up the changes. The new default configuration values are as follows.

settings of tahof-yahap:
quenwyn:
  log_level: error
  metrics_host: metrics.quenwyn.lumiclabs.internal
  pool_size: 8

Security-relevant rules (no dynamic string
 * concatenation, mandatory parameter binding, forbidden GRANT ALL) are
 * pinned here and cannot be disabled per-file. Reviewers should confirm
 * this constant matches the version approved in the Thornbury audit
 * baseline before sign-off. Any bump requires a fresh scan of legacy
 * migrations. The approved ruleset build is identified by the token
 * recorded on the next line.
 */

pipeline stamp: htk3_69f

## Deployment — PayLedge export v3

Payroll export moved from fixed-width to the new delimited format this sprint. Downstream at Fernbrook Accounting both formats are accepted until end of quarter; after that v2 is rejected. Deploy exporter and validator together — mismatched versions corrupt the batch header. Rollback is a single flag flip. Current production configuration for the exporter is below.

deployment values, kajep-kageg:
[praix]
host = praix.paliqcorp.corp
user = praix_svc
database = praix_prod